COMPX102

Object-Oriented Programming

2022

15

100

B Trimester, and other teaching periods

Hamilton, Online, Tauranga, Internet Waikato College, Hangzhou City University, Hangzhou China

One of COMPX101, COMP103, ENGEN103, or ENGG182

COMP104

To see available locations for each teaching period, view the teaching periods and locations table.

This paper continues from COMPX101, expanding upon data organisation and algorithms, and introducing code contracts, computer architecture, Boolean algebra, assembly language, program analysis and object-oriented programming.

Teaching Periods and Locations

  • 22C (NWC)
    Cancelled
    Contact the School or Faculty Office for more information.
22B (HAM)
Paper outline
B Trimester :
18 Jul 2022 - 13 Nov 2022
Hamilton On-campus 67% internal assessment, 33% examinations
22B (NET)
Paper outline
B Trimester :
18 Jul 2022 - 13 Nov 2022
Online Online 100% internal assessment
22B (TGA)
Paper outline
B Trimester :
18 Jul 2022 - 13 Nov 2022
Tauranga On-campus 67% internal assessment, 33% examinations
22C (NWC)
Cancelled Contact the School or Faculty Office for more information.
22H (HAM)
Paper outline
H Semester :
03 Jan 2022 - 20 Feb 2022
Hamilton On-campus 67% internal assessment, 33% examinations
22X (ZUC)
Paper outline
28 Feb 2022 - 03 Jul 2022 Hangzhou City University, Hangzhou China On-campus 100% internal assessment

If your paper outline is not linked below, try the previous year's version of this paper.

This paper is prerequisite for a major in Computer Science. The practical programme must be completed to the satisfaction of the Convenor. NWC occurrences of this paper are exclusively for International Diploma students. Please contact the University of Waikato College for more information.

Timetabled lectures

22B (HAM) 22B (TGA) 22H (HAM)
Name Day Time Room Dates
Lecture 1 Mon 12:00 PM - 1:00 PM - Jul 18 - Oct 23
Lecture 2 Thur 1:00 PM - 2:00 PM L.G.01, Hamilton Jul 21 - Oct 23
Lecture 3 Fri 12:00 PM - 1:00 PM L.G.01, Hamilton Jul 22 - Oct 23
Visit the online timetable for this paper for more details
Name Day Time Room Dates
Lecture 1 Mon 12:00 PM - 1:00 PM TCBD.2.08, Tauranga Jul 18 - Oct 23
Lecture 2 Mon 3:00 PM - 4:00 PM TCBD.2.09, Tauranga Jul 18 - Oct 23
Lecture 3 Fri 10:00 AM - 11:00 AM TCBD.2.13, Tauranga Jul 22 - Oct 23
Visit the online timetable for this paper for more details
Name Day Time Room Dates
Lecture 1 Mon 11:00 AM - 1:00 PM - Jan 10 - Jan 30
Lecture 2 Wed 11:00 AM - 1:00 PM K.G.07, Hamilton Jan 5 - Feb 13
Lecture 3 Fri 11:00 AM - 1:00 PM K.G.07, Hamilton Jan 7 - Feb 13
Visit the online timetable for this paper for more details

Indicative Fees

  • You will be sent an enrolment agreement which will confirm your fees. Tuition fees shown are indicative only and may change. There are additional fees and charges related to enrolment - please see the Table of Fees and Charges for more information.

Domestic
International
22B (HAM) $926
22B (NET) $926
22B (TGA) $926
22C (NWC) $926
22H (HAM) $926
22X (ZUC) $926

You will be sent an enrolment agreement which will confirm your fees. Tuition fees shown are indicative only and may change. There are additional fees and charges related to enrolment - please see the Table of Fees and Charges for more information.

22B (HAM) $4,136
22B (NET) $4,136
22B (TGA) $4,136
22C (NWC) $4,136
22H (HAM) $4,136
22X (ZUC) $4,136

You will be sent an enrolment agreement which will confirm your fees. Tuition fees shown are indicative only and may change. There are additional fees and charges related to enrolment - please see the Table of Fees and Charges for more information.

Available subjects

Additional information

  • Paper details current as of 1 Jun 2024 17:22pm
  • Indicative fees current as of 29 Oct 2024 01:20am